Expert Review
This Security Officer role at Mitie Cleaning & Hygiene Services offers a solid entry point into the security industry. Candidates must obtain a front-line licence, which can take time and costs. Without this certification, applicants will face immediate disqualification.
The job focuses on protecting property and assets, which can provide rewarding experiences in community safety. However, the specifics of hours and salary are not detailed, which might deter those looking for clear financial expectations.
